Hanu Man (also marketed as HanuMan) is a 2024 Indian Telugu-language superhero film written and directed by Prasanth Varma and produced by Primeshow Entertainment.[4] It stars Teja Sajja in the title role, alongside Amritha Aiyer, Varalaxmi Sarathkumar, Raj Deepak Shetty and Vinay Rai.[5] The film is set in the fictional village of Anjanadri and is the first installment of the Prasanth Varma Cinematic Universe (PVCU).[6][7]

The film was officially announced in May 2021. Principal photography commenced on 25 June 2021 in Hyderabad and was wrapped by mid-April 2023. The film has music composed by Anudeep Dev, GowraHari and Krishna Saurabh, cinematography by Dasaradhi Sivendra, visual effects supervised by Venkat Kumar Jetty, and editing by Sai Babu Talari.

Hanuman was released on 12 January 2024, on the occasion of Sankranti to positive reviews from critics. The film has grossed over 200 crore (US$25 million) till now, emerging as the year's second highest grossing Indian film and Telugu film.[3]

Director Prasanth Varma has announced the sequel to the movie Hanu Man, titled "Jai Hanu Man" has commenced pre-production work on the occasion of the inauguration of Ayodhya Ram Mandir. [8]

Plot

In Saurashtra, a young Michael's mania for superheroes instigates him to murder his own parents, who oppose his obsession. Years later, Michael, an admired superhero, now christens himself as "Mega Man" and thwarts a burglary attempt and slays the robbers. He recruits the assistance of his friend, Siri Vennela's innovations, but yearns to possess a power that would make him a real and formidable superhero.

Lord Indra's assault on an infant Hanuman to deter his attempts of feeding on the Sun God terminated in the spilling of his divine blood, a drop of which plunged into the sea and eventually progressed into a holy gem. Situated on a sea shore, Anjanadri, a dystopian hamlet, is agonized under the tyranny of the polygar, Gajapathi. Hanumanthu, a petty thief in Anjanadri, has a huge crush on Meenakshi, a doctor and the local school head master's granddaughter. She constantly combats Gajapathi's despotism, prompting him to oppress the rebellion in the village and launch a false bandit attack on Meenakshi; Hanumanthu manages to avert the ambush and rescue Meenakshi, but is severely wounded and thrown into the sea. He discovers the gem and acquires it, while Meenakshi pines to uncover the identity of her savior, who has been aiding her since their childhood but does not expose himself.

Hanumanthu is found unconscious on the shore with serious wounds, but miraculously recuperates due to the gem, surprising his elder sister, Anjamma, and best friend, Kasi. As a result of coming into contact with the gem and owning it, he attains exceptional superpowers. While Hanumanthu's efforts to win over Meenakshi humorously fail, he revels in his newfound superpowers and confides in Kasi. Meenakshi confronts Gajapathi for compelling an aged farmer to attempt suicide and he challengers her to a customary kusthi match. Hanumanthu comes forward to represent Meenakshi against Gajapathi, and defeats him in the match. He is recruited to be the polygar, but disagrees with the villagers and proposes democratic elections to decide the new leader, impressing Meenakshi. Out of nowhere, Michael and Siri arrive at Anjanadri under the pretext of corporate social responsibility and offer to construct a hospital.

It is revealed that Michael had found out about Hanumanthu's newly-acquired superpowers through a social media clip and desires to uncover the root cause of his capabilities. He fabricates a crane collapse to provoke Hanumanthu into using his powers, but fails to discern the reason behind them. Hanumanthu realizes Anjamma's unconditional love for him through Kasi's grandmother and repents hurting her with his conduct; he undertakes the household's responsibility and arranges her wedding. Siri later abducts Hanumanthu for the information pertaining to his powers and threatens him to disclose the details, while Michael uncovers the gem's potential and tries cautioning Siri, but the latter does not pay any heed. Hanumanthu fools Siri and breaks free to rescue Meenakshi from hooligans sent after her by Gajapathi; he professes his feelings to her, reveals that he had been her saviour, and discloses about the gem and his powers.

Hanumanthu breaks into Michael's caravan, while the latter leaves Siri, an asthma patient, to succumb to his asthma attack when he refuses to stand by his hazardous conspiracies to acquire the gem. Michael's men strike Hanumanthu, but an elderly sage, disguising himself as Hanumanthu, pounces on the goons and rescues him. On Anjamma's wedding day, Michael accuses Hanumanthu of robbing him of his money and an ancestral gem; upon Anjamma's instructions, Hanumanthu returns the gem, but it turns out to be made of a magnifying glass that damages Michael's eye and exposes his true colours. As Hanumanthu divulges to the villagers about the gem, Michael instructs his henchmen to kill him, but Anjamma fights for her brother and takes a bullet in the process, killing her. Frustrated with the gem's inability to rescue Anjamma due to the sunset, Hanumanthu throws it away and tearfully cremates her, while Michael releases a toxic smoke through drones into the village to slowly decimate it and obtain the gem. Discovering his plot, Meenakshi rushes to seek Hanumanthu out, but he distrusts himself with the responsibility of rescuing the village.

The elderly sage interrupts their conversation, and discloses himself to be Vibhishana. Vibhishana reveals to Hanumanthu and Meenakshi, that Hanumanthu's powers are exactly of those of Lord Hanuman, and explains his presence in Hanumanthu's life ever since he acquired the gem. With newfound motivation, Hanumanthu decides to obliterate Michael. Siri, who was rescued by Hanumanthu, undergoes a change of heart and persuades Gajapathi and his men to help Hanumanthu for Anjanadri and tries deactivating the drones. Hanumanthu, Gajapathi, and the latter's men battle Michael and his henchmen. A monkey calling himself as "Koti", assists Hanumanthu by getting him the gem, who then manages to destroy the drones, desisting the release of smoke. However, Michael obtains the gem through his new "Mega Man" suit, but cannot stop Hanumanthu with his power. He finally attempts to destroy Anjanadri from his helicopter; Hanumanthu resists him and explodes the helicopter, killing Michael and destroying the gem for good, however, the blood drop inculcates itself permanently into Hanumanthu.

While Vibhishana anticipates a tremendous battle with the Asuras, Lord Hanuman emerges out of a cave in the Himalayas and appears before Hanumanthu. Vibhishana recounts a promise made by Lord Hanuman to Lord Rama and declares that the time for him to stand by his oath has finally come, paving way to the sequel, Jai HanuMan.

Production

Development

After successfully directing Zombie Reddy (2021), Varma announced his fourth film on 29 May 2021, coinciding with his birthday.[13][14] It was announced that the film will be the first superhero film in Telugu cinema.[15][16] In an interview with Deccan Chronicle said that "the film is inspired by the Hindu God Hanuman", adding "As for the title of the film, Prasanth says he chose it because it was a dedication to many who, when they think of any superpower or a superhero in Hinduism, we remember Lord Hanuman. In the film, the name of the protagonist is Hanu-Man", regarding the title of the film.[17]

The film was funded by the American NRI film distributor, Kandagatla Niranjan Reddy, under Primeshow Entertainment.[18] It was made on a shoe-string budget of 20 crores.[19] During the teaser launch event held in Hyderabad in November 2022, Varma revealed that the production budget increased six times from the initial valuation.[20] HanuMan is the first installment of the Prasanth Varma Cinematic Universe (PVCU).[21]

Pre-production

The story of HanuMan came from Varma and was then developed by his team at Scriptsville, a writing team he co-founded with his sister, Sneha Sameera.[22] In an interview, Varma said that his education in a gurukul helped him with the film's research.[23] Varma also sought S. S. Rajamouli's advice while making the film.[24]

Anudeep Dev, GowraHari, and Krishna Saurabh were hired to compose the music for the film.[25] GowraHari composed the background score for the film.[26] Sai Babu Tallari was hired for the editing, reuniting with Varma after Zombie Reddy.[27] The other technicians includes cinematographer Dasaradhi Sivendra, production designer Nagendra Tangala, costume designer Lanka Santhoshi.[28][29] Asrin Reddy is the executive producer, Venkat Kumar Jetty is the line producer and Kushal Reddy and Pushpak Reddy are the associate producers of the film.[30]

Prior to starting the first shooting schedule, the team had constructed a studio at leased land at Vattinagulapally located in Telangana, for filming green screen shots.[22]

Casting

Teja Sajja played the titular character Hanumanthu, a superhero, and sported long hair and bearded look.[31] This marked Tejja's third collaboration with Varma after their Zombie Reddy and Adbhutham (2021).[32] Amritha Aiyer was cast as the film's lead actress, and her character name Meenakshi was revealed in December 2021.[33] Varalaxmi Sarathkumar was roped in a pivotal role, and her inclusion was confirmed on 4 March 2022, on Eve of her birthday.[34] Tamil actor Vinay Rai was announced as the film's antagonist in June 2022.[35]

The film also features Vennela Kishore, Satya, Samuthirakani, Getup Srinu, Raj Deepak Shetty, Koushik Mahata and Bhanu Prakash in pivotal roles.[36] Ravi Teja gave his voice to the monkey character Koti.[37] The name of the fictional village was announced as Anjanadri.[38]

Filming

The film was officially launched on 25 June 2021 in Hyderabad, with a pooja ceremony and muhurtam shot done.[39] Principal photography of the film was also done on the same day.[40] As of August 2021, 40% of filming was completed. Filming of a few action sequences and songs took place at Maredumilli and Paderu in Andhra Pradesh in September 2021.[41][42] Around 60% of filming was completed by December 2021.[43]

The team constructed a temporary studio called Hanuman Studio at Vattinagulapally, where most of the green screen shots portions were filmed.-For wide angle visuals, the team moved to Paderu and Maredumilli in Andhra Pradesh.[22] The underwater sequence was filmed in December 2022.[44]

The climax sequence were filmed for five days.[45] Principal photography wrapped by 17 April 2023, with filming having lasted 130 working days.[46]

Post-production

The dubbing process began during April 2022, with Teja Sajja dubbing his portions.[47] HaloHues Studios, Hyderabad was the film's principal visual effects studio.[48] Extensive work on the visual effects took place for more than a year during the post-production process.[49] It took nearly six months for the visual effects shots of Lord Hanuman.[45] The final edit had around 1600 visual effects shots, which constituted approximately 30% of the film.[22] In an interview, Prasanth Varma discussed the utilisation of pre-visualization, matte painting, 3D, and AI art in the film.[22] Reportedly, the use of ChatGPT and Midjourney eased the burden on the team.[50]

The final copy of the film was ready by December 2023, and was submitted to the Central Board of Film Certification (CBFC) that month. On 29 December 2023, the film received a U/A certificate from the Censor Board, with a finalised runtime of 158 minutes.[51]

The music of the film is composed by Anudeep Dev, GowraHari and Krishna Saurabh. The audio rights were acquired by Tips Industries.[52]

The first single titled "Hanuman Chalisa" was released on 6 April 2023, coinciding Hanuman Janmotsav.[53] The second single titled "SuperHero HanuMan" was released on 14 November 2023, coinciding Children's Day.[54] The third single titled "Avakaya Anjaneya" was released on 28 November 2023.[55] The fourth single titled "Sri Ramadootha Stotram" was released on 3 January 2024.[56]

Marketing

On 21 November 2022, the official teaser of the film was released.[57] TA taser launch event was held at AMB Cinemas., Hyderabad[58] The team introduced NFT collectibles on 13 December 2022, becoming the first Telugu film to do so.[59] On 28 November 2023, Avakaya Anjaneya song launch event was held at Hyderabad.[60] Teja Sajja promoted the film at SREEVISION'23 at Sreenidhi Institute of Science and Technology that held on 12 December 2023.[61]

The official trailer was released on 18 December 2023 in five languages.[62] Trailer launch event was held at AMB Cinemas.[63] Subsequently, the trailer was attached to the prints of Salaar: Part 1 – Ceasefire for theatrical screenings. [64] On 24 December, Teja Sajja promoted the film at the Star Sports Telugu Pro Kabaddi League.[65] Later, on 31 December, a video was released titled "SESH X HANUMAN" on YouTube, in which Adivi Sesh interviewed Prasanth Varma and Teja Sajja.[66]

Soon after, the team has planned a promotional tour, titled "The Superhero Tour," across six cities over six days, starting from 4 January 2024 to 9 January 2024.[67] On the first day of the tour, the team headed to Kochi for a press meeting at Crowne Plaza.[68] On the second day, the team moved to Chennai to attend interviews and press meetings at the Green Park Hotel.[69] Later, interviews and press meet were held at The Shelton Grand Hotel, Bengaluru.[70] On the fourth day, Mega Pre-Release Utsav was held at N Convention in Hyderabad.[71] Chiranjeevi was the chief guest of the event, which was hosted by Suma Kanakala.[72] On the fifth day, an event was held by the film's Hindi distributor, AA Films, at the PVR Citi Mall in Mumbai, where the cast and crew interacted with the media and fans. Rana Daggubati was the chief guest at the event.[73] On sixth day, the team visited the Hanuman Mandir in New Delhi and interacted with the local media to promote their film in the region.[74]

Release

Theatrical

The film was theatrically released on 12 January 2024 in Telugu, along with the dubbed versions of Tamil, Malayalam, Kannada and Hindi.[75] In an interview Varma revealed that distributors in Japan and Korea approached the makers after watching the teaser.[76]

Distribution

Mythri Movie Makers distributed the film in the Nizam (Telangana) region.[77] The film was distributed across Andhra Pradesh by Teja Pictures (Guntur), Abhi Cinemas (Nellore), Sai Chandra Films (Ceeded), Primeshow Films (Uttarandhra), Sri Venkata Padmavathi Films (East Godavari) and Dheeraj Mogilineni Entertainment (West Godavari and Krishna district).[78] Sakthi Film Factory acquired the distribution rights to the film in Tamil Nadu.[49] Sree Gokulam Movies acquired the distribution rights to the film in Kerala.[79] The Karnataka theatrical rights were acquired by KRG Studios.[80] AA Films released the film in North India.[81] Primeshow Entertainment and Nirvana Cinemas released the film in North America.[82]

Home media

In February 2022, it was reported that the film's digital rights were acquired by ZEE5 and Zee Network acquired the satellite rights of the film.[83] The combined deal of post-theatrical streaming and satellite rights were reported to be 35 crore.[19]

Reception

Critical response

On the review aggregator website Rotten Tomatoes, 83% of 6 critics' reviews are positive, with an average rating of 5.5/10.[84]

Paul Nicodemus of The Times of India gave 3.5/5 stars and wrote "With solid storytelling, impressive visuals, and strong performances, the film successfully merges elements of mythology with contemporary action, offering a unique viewing experience in Indian cinema."[85] Bhavana Sharma of Deccan Chronicle gave 3.5/5 and stated "HanuMan" stands as a solid entertainer with a rich tapestry of drama, emotions, and mythology skillfully woven together."[86] Sana Farzeen of India Today gave 3.5/5 stars and wrote "The music is quite pleasant and the VFX department has done a fair job. Also, the comedy scenes had the theatre laughing out loud, and would definitely tickle the young and older audiences' funny bones."[87] Abhimanyu Mathur of DNA India gave 3.5/5 stars and wrote "HanuMan is a brilliant, visually stunning effort from Prasanth Varma in blending mythology with the superhero genre."[88]

Rishil Jogani from Pinkvilla gave 3.5/5 stars and wrote "HanuMan is the first surprise package of 2024 as director Prasanth Varma brings out his ambition to the big screen with utmost conviction. The film entertains with the right amount of drama, action, comedy, and devotional value. What holds attention apart from the vision of creating something magical is also the non-serious approach to the superhero tale."[89] Bhargav Chaganti from NTV gave 3.5/5 stars and stated that "Hanuman – Goosebumps Guaranteed Film. Enjoy the festival with the whole family without any hindrance."[90] Y Maheswara Reddy of Bangalore Mirror gave 3.5/5 stars and stated that Prashant Varma "has succeeded in aptly mixing mythology with social elements such as exploitation of the poor by the greedy and underdeveloped villages and the lifestyle of people in such villages. Computer-generated images are a visual treat for family as well as mass audiences, especially children."[91]

Saki of Telangana Today wrote that "HanuMan is the best technically made film in recent times in Telugu. The music, visuals, VFX, and all other production elements totally shine in every episode."[92] Sangeetha Devi Dundoo of The Hindu wrote that Director Prasanth Varma and actor Teja Sajja’s superhero film blends the familiar good versus evil superpower template with a touch of devotion, and tops it with entertaining masala segments"[93] Ram Venkata Srikar of Film Companion wrote that "Hanu Man is an inspiring start, It might just be the biggest surprise for Sankranthi."[94]

Box office

The film grossed 15 crore (US$1.9 million) on its opening day in India.[95] HanuMan's Hindi version collected a net of 6.2 crore (US$780,000) in two days domestically.[96] In its three days of theatrical run, the film grossed over 75 crore (US$9.4 million) worldwide,[97] with 46.5 crore (US$5.8 million) from India.[98] 12.26 crore (US$1.5 million) was came from Hindi dubbed version alone in three days.[99] The film grossed over 100 crore (US$13 million) four days of its release.[100]

Future

A sequel, titled Jai HanuMan, was announced in the end credits of the film.[101] It was revealed that Lord Hanuman would have more prominence than the character of Hanumanthu in the film.[102] This film is the first film in a future shared universe of superhero films created by Prasanth Varma, based on Hinduism with Adhira going to be the second installment.[103]
